Goals

  • To teach children communication and social skills
  • To build meaningful relationships in our school community
  • To learn swing dancing as a social activity
  • To ensure, swing dance, an original American art form continues

Overview

Building Community Through Dance brings together elementary students, their parents, siblings, grandparents, teen dancers, college students, and other senior adults in our community. Our mission is to use swing dance to build meaningful relationships within our community and to pass on the tradition of this American art form. •Students will learn the Big Apple, the Shim Sham, and Lindy Hop moves from Vanaver Caravan dancers, Evita Arce and Michael Jagger. •Older students will be dance partners with our younger students while they learn new steps. •Students will practice their dancing with college students from RPI's Swing Club. •Parents will receive swing dance lessons from Isabelle's School of Dance high school dance team. •Each classroom of students will "adopt" a senior adult from an assisted living facility to share histories and to dance with. •A Community Dance in June with live swing music will help everyone celebrate all of the social and communication skills we have learned.

How will the 25K be Used?

$ 6,000 2 dance instructors - 1 week in April
$ 5,000 Alan Thomson Little Big Band
$ 6,000 2 dance instructors - 1 week in June
$ 8,000 Peter Davis & Lindy Hop Heaven - 1 week
